When you need a WorldTides key

If offline tides do not cover your area (e.g. many North Sea / Mediterranean ports), use live tides via WorldTides — with your own API key (BYOK).

Step 1: WorldTides account

  1. Register on the WorldTides website
  2. Create an API key (dashboard)
  3. Check quota/cost with the provider — NauticCalc does not sell a tides subscription

Step 2: Store the key safely

  • Copy the key and do not share it in chats or public repos
  • If lost: create a new key with the provider

Step 3: Enter in NauticCalc

  1. Open the app → Settings (tides / API)
  2. Paste the WorldTides API key
  3. Save — the key stays in the iOS keychain, not on NauticCalc servers

Step 4: Test a station

  1. Choose harbour/area in Tides
  2. Compare HW/LW and windows with official tables or port info
  3. If off: check station or time zone

Without a key

Core calculators, logbook and offline tides (where stations exist) still work — no forced key.
